Price for Oil Seeds; Sunflower Seeds, Whether or Not Broken in Guatemala (CIF) - 2022
The average import price for sunflower seed stood at $1,098 per ton in 2022, with a decrease of -3% against the previous year. Overall, import price indicated a pronounced expansion from 2012 to 2022: its price increased at an average annual rate of +2.8% over the last decade.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2022 figures, import price for sunflower seed increased by +51.1% against 2016 indices.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2013 an increase of 29%. The import price peaked at $1,137 per ton in 2015; afterwards, it flattened through to 2022.
Prices varied noticeably by country of origin: am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was the United States ($4,188 per ton), while the price for Argentina ($1,018 per ton) was amongst the lowest.
From 2012 to 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by Argentina (+2.6%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ced mixed trend patterns.
Price for Oil Seeds; Sunflower Seeds, Whether or Not Broken in Guatemala (FOB) - 2022
In 2022, the average export price for sunflower seed amounted to $2,824 per ton, growing by 94% against the previous year. Over the period under review, the export price showed a buoyant increase.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2019 when the average export price increased by 107%. Over the period under review, the average export prices hit record highs in 2022 and is expected to retain growth in years to come.
Prices varied noticeably by country of destination: amid the top suppliers, the country with the highest price was Panama ($5,701 per ton), while the average price for exports to Honduras ($1,893 per ton) was amongst the lowest.
From 2012 to 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was recorded for supplies to El Salvador (+14.3%), while the prices for the other major destinations experienced more modest paces of growth.
Imports of Oil Seeds; Sunflower Seeds, Whether or Not Broken in Guatemala
In 2022, imports of sunflower seed into Guatemala rose sharply to 813 tons, surging by 8.8% on the previous year. Over the period under review, imports showed a relatively flat trend pattern.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2020 when imports increased by 9.2%. As a result, imports attained the peak of 880 tons. From 2021 to 2022, the growth of imports of failed to regain momentum.
In value terms, imports of sunflower seed rose rapidly to $893K in 2022. The total import value increased at an average annual rate of +7.5% from 2019 to 2022; the trend pattern remained consistent, with only minor f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2020 when imports increased by 16%. Imports peaked in 2022 and are expected to retain growth in the immediate term.

Exports of Oil Seeds; Sunflower Seeds, Whether or Not Broken in Guatemala
For the third consecutive year, Guatemala recorded decline in shipments abroad of sunflower seed, which decreased by -35.8% to 14 tons in 2022. Overall, exports recorded a significant contraction. The smallest decline of -10.9% was in 2020.
In value terms, exports of sunflower seed skyrocketed to $38K in 2022. In general, exports faced a abrupt setback.
